This morning, our current Kindy B students will have the opportunity to meet their 2026 class teacher and peers. The transition morning will occur from 9:00 – 10:30am.

All parents of students returning to Piara Waters Primary School will receive an email with their 2026 class details. Class lists will also be placed outside 2026 classrooms on Monday afternoon to assist students with their transition.

You will find a list and photographs of our 2026 classroom teachers and a classroom map on our school website. 

Parents will not need to sign in but enter through the Early Childhood gate at 8:50am.  Please take your child to their 2026 Pre-primary classroom ready for 9am.  You then need to return to collect your child at 10:30am.  Parents do not attend the Pre-primary to Year 6 transition classes.

A social story has been written to help support students know what to expect during the transition morning.

Colour Run (P&C fundraiser)

P&C Colour Run (major fundraiser)

Our Parents and Citizens Association (P&C) will hold their major fundraiser on Friday, 12 December.  All funds raised will go toward more outdoor equipment across the Kindergarten to Year 6 play areas.

Their annual Colour-a-thon requires students to collect sponsorship for participating in the scheduled run.  

For every $10 raised, students will receive a ticket into the prize draw.  Prizes will include a Bike (voucher $200), Razor Ripstick, Lego and various sporting equipment and games.

On the day, students will wear a white shirt and run around the oval whilst being “coloured” by our staff and P&C volunteers.

Icy Poles for Sale (Lunch time)

On Friday, Kindergarten to Year 6 students may bring $1 to purchase an icy pole at lunchtime.  All proceeds go to the 2026, Year 6 camp. 

As well as a fundraiser, this is also an opportunity for students to learn money skills.  Students are responsible for taking care of their $1 and lining up to make their lunchtime purchase. 

Icy Poles will be on sale each Friday at lunchtime in the Undercover Area.
